Integrated total pelvic floor ultrasound in pelvic floor dysfunction
Integrated total pelvic floor ultrasound is a combination of endoanal, transperineal, and endovaginal ultrasound used for the static and dynamic assessment of the entire pelvic floor.

Prevalence of co-existing pelvic floor disorders: A scoping review in males and females
Introduction:: Dysfunction of the pelvic floor may lead to pelvic floor symptoms within different domains simultaneously, such as lower urinary tract symptoms (LUTS), bowel symptoms, pelvic organ prolapse, sexual problems and genito-pelvic pain.
